For return on investment in other homeland security, law enforcement, firefighting & related protective services, no school beat University Of Massachusetts Lowell this year. University Of Massachusetts Lowell is a very large public school located in the suburb of Lowell.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$16,966, compared with $36,264 for out-of-state students. Other Homeland Security, Law Enforcement, Firefighting & Related Protective Services graduates carry a median of $25,574 in student loans. Early-career other homeland security, law enforcement, firefighting & related protective services graduates make about $66,985.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value. Roughly 83% of applicants are accepted.

2

The strong cost-to-outcome balance at Massachusetts Maritime Academy earned it the #2 place for other homeland security, law enforcement, firefighting & related protective services. Set in the suburb of Buzzards Bay, Massachusetts Maritime Academy is a small public institution.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$11,420, compared with $23,722 for out-of-state students. Students borrow a median of $25,000 to complete the other homeland security, law enforcement, firefighting & related protective services program here. Soon after graduation, other homeland security, law enforcement, firefighting & related protective services degree recipients from Massachusetts Maritime Academy generally make around $70,995. Weighed against typical debt, the earnings make a compelling case for value. Massachusetts Maritime Academy admits about 95% of applicants.

3
University Of New Haven crest
University Of New Haven
West Haven, CT

University Of New Haven came in at #3 on our 2026 list of the best value other homeland security, law enforcement, firefighting & related protective services schools. Located in the suburb of West Haven, University Of New Haven is a large private not-for-profit university.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$47,332. Other Homeland Security, Law Enforcement, Firefighting & Related Protective Services graduates carry a median of $27,000 in student loans. Other Homeland Security, Law Enforcement, Firefighting & Related Protective Services graduates of University Of New Haven earn a median of $42,455 early in their careers. Set against $27,000 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ff. The acceptance rate is 60%.

Notes and References

This list is compiled by College Factual (MF_RANKING_2025), 2026 edition. Schools are scored on the balance of cost (tuition and student debt) against student outcomes (post-graduation earnings) — a measure of return on investment, drawn primarily from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S and College Scorecard).

Ranking method: College Major Best Value · 7 schools evaluated.
